Abstract

I will begin reviewing the Callan-Harvey mechanism of anomaly inflow with particular focus on topological edge states and show how the  inflow  picture naturally converts the non-covariant  "consistent" gauge anomaly  of Bardeen and Zumino to the more physical "covariant" anomaly. I will then  discuss some recent  derivations of the covariant form of the gauge anomaly from classical phase space flows.
